Understanding the Acer Predator X32 FP

The Acer Predator X32 FP features a 32-inch 4K UHD display with a 144Hz refresh rate and a 1ms response time. It supports NVIDIA G-SYNC and AMD FreeSync technologies, ensuring smooth gameplay. Its high color accuracy and HDR support make it ideal for both gaming and content creation. To fully utilize its capabilities, a powerful GPU is essential.

Performance with a Single High-End GPU

When paired with a top-tier GPU like the NVIDIA RTX 4090, the Acer Predator X32 FP delivers exceptional performance. Gamers experience high frame rates at 4K resolution, often exceeding 120fps in demanding titles. The display’s G-SYNC technology effectively eliminates screen tearing, providing smooth visuals even during intense action sequences.

Performance with Mid-Range GPUs

Mid-range GPUs like the NVIDIA RTX 4070 Ti or AMD RX 7800 XT can still provide a satisfying gaming experience on the X32 FP. While frame rates may hover around 60-100fps at 4K, settings adjustments such as lowering shadow quality or enabling DLSS/FSR can enhance performance. The monitor’s high resolution emphasizes the need for balanced GPU power to maintain smooth gameplay.
